Bengal: TMC Blames BSF, Urges Governor To 'Fix Accountability' For Death Of 4 Children In North Dinajpur

TMC accused the BSF of negligence, attributing the deaths of children to the alleged unauthorised activities, claiming it was engaged in "illegal" drain expansion work in Chopra in North Dinajpur.

New Delhi: West Bengal's ruling party Trinamool Congress on Tuesday urged Governor Ananda Bose to fix accountability in the North Dinajpur incident following the deaths of four children who lost their lives in a village. The TMC urged the Governor to visit the site and "fix accountability" for the "monumental tragedy."  TMC accused the Border Security Force (BSF) of negligence, attributing the deaths of the innocent children to the alleged unauthorised activities, claiming force was engaged in "illegal" drain expansion work in Chopra.

AITC posted on X, "Yesterday, 4 innocent children lost their lives in Uttar Dinajpur's Chopra during an illegal drain expansion by @BSF_India. Our MPs Pratima Mondal and Dola Sen wrote a letter to the Governor, who has agreed to meet our delegation on February 15th. We request that he show the same urgency in visiting Chopra and fixing accountability that he did by cutting short his trip from Kerala to visit Sandeshkhali".

AITC also stated that, "Our silent protest today reflects the deep pain & sorrow caused by the tragic deaths of 4 innocent children due to @BSF_India 's negligence in Uttar Dinajpur's Chopra. For what crime did these innocent souls pay the ultimate price, HM @AmitShah? At the protest site, each face bears the weight of mourning, demanding accountability & justice for these precious lives lost".

TMC's Meet With Bengal Guv Over Uttar DinajpurIncident

Shashi Panja, a TMC leader and West Bengal Women and Child Development Minister, said, "We want to meet the Governor, a delegation of 12 members from the political party has been given time by him on February 15. We will meet him at noon at Raj Bhavan and tell him about the incident that happened in Chopra, Uttar Dinajpur," she told ANI. 

The delegation includes key figures such as Chandrima Bhattacharya, Firhad Hakim, Aroop Biswas, Udayan Guha, Bratya Basu, Dr. Shashi Panja, Birbaha Hansda, Gautam Deb, Dola Sen, Pratima Mondal, Jagadish Chandra Barma Basunia, and Kunal Ghosh.
